45:8B-49. Confidentiality of communications

Any communication between a licensed professional counselor, licensed associate counselor or licensed rehabilitation counselor and the person or persons counseled while performing counseling or rehabilitation counseling shall be confidential and its secrecy preserved. This privilege shall not be subject to waiver, except when disclosure is required by State law or when the licensed professional counselor, licensed associate counselor or licensed rehabilitation counselor is a party defendant to a civil, criminal or disciplinary action arising from that counseling or rehabilitation counseling, in which case the waiver of the privilege accorded by this section shall be limited to that action.
L.1993,c.340,s.16; amended 1997, c.155, s.14; per s.20 of 1993, c.340, act to expire if certain contingency met.
